Transaction 6db7faba7b6925c3b642dd64e0c1c5c554b1b8a0f2479d1825aa781a7843316a
2 Input
2 Outputs
- 6db7faba7b6925c3b642dd64e0c1c5c554b1b8a0f2479d1825aa781a7843316a:0
- 6db7faba7b6925c3b642dd64e0c1c5c554b1b8a0f2479d1825aa781a7843316a:1
value 5871860
address 1Q8ZuZuWhAQv8qBsLi36EL3Ca3bChc7G1w
value 404055000
address 38cNpJ46yRRLWqaSi1bS256LmJNs4FdDYm